By Enoch O. Hwang
This booklet will educate scholars tips to layout electronic common sense circuits, particularly combinational and sequential circuits. scholars will how you can positioned those varieties of circuits jointly to shape devoted and general-purpose microprocessors. This ebook is exclusive in that it combines using good judgment ideas and the development of person elements to create info paths and regulate devices, and eventually the development of genuine devoted customized microprocessors and general-purpose microprocessors. After realizing the fabric within the booklet, scholars might be in a position to layout basic microprocessors and enforce them in actual undefined.
Read Online or Download Digital Logic and Microprocessor Design With VHDL PDF
Similar microprocessors & system design books
This publication will train scholars tips to layout electronic common sense circuits, particularly combinational and sequential circuits. scholars will easy methods to positioned those kinds of circuits jointly to shape committed and general-purpose microprocessors. This publication is exclusive in that it combines using good judgment ideas and the development of person elements to create facts paths and regulate devices, and at last the development of genuine committed customized microprocessors and general-purpose microprocessors.
Industry call for for microprocessor functionality has influenced persevered scaling of CMOS via a succession of lithography generations. Quantum mechanical barriers to persevered scaling are changing into effectively obvious. partly Depleted Silicon-on-Insulator (PD-SOI) know-how is rising as a promising technique of addressing those obstacles.
The coming and recognition of multi-core processors has sparked a renewed curiosity within the improvement of parallel courses. equally, the supply of inexpensive microprocessors and sensors has generated an exceptional curiosity in embedded real-time courses. This booklet presents scholars and programmers whose backgrounds are in conventional sequential programming with the chance to extend their services into parallel, embedded, real-time and disbursed computing.
This booklet makes a speciality of quite a few suggestions of computational intelligence, either unmarried ones and people which shape hybrid tools. these thoughts are at the present time regularly utilized problems with synthetic intelligence, e. g. to strategy speech and normal language, construct professional platforms and robots. the 1st a part of the ebook provides tools of information illustration utilizing diverse suggestions, specifically the tough units, type-1 fuzzy units and type-2 fuzzy units.
Additional info for Digital Logic and Microprocessor Design With VHDL
Otherwise, F evaluates to a 0. 7 under the column labeled F. Notice that the four rows in the table where F = 1 match the four cases in the description above. 7 under the column labeled F'. Therefore, we can write the Boolean function for F' in the sum-of-products format, where the AND terms are obtained from those rows where F' = 1. Thus, we get F' = x'y'z' + x'y'z + x'yz' + xy'z' To deduce F' algebraically from F requires the use of DeMorgan’s Theorem (Theorem 15a) twice. For example, using the same function F = xy'z + xyz' + yz we obtain F' as follows F' = (xy'z + xyz' + yz)' = (xy'z)' • (xyz')' • (yz)' = (x'+y+z' ) • (x'+y'+z) • (y'+z' ) There are three things to notice about this equation for F'.
We start by constructing a truth table, which is basically a precise way of stating the operations for the device. The table will have three input columns M, D, and V, and an output column S as shown below 46 Digital Logic and Microprocessor Design with VHDL M 0 0 0 0 1 1 1 1 Chapter 2 - Digital Circuits D 0 0 1 1 0 0 1 1 V 0 1 0 1 0 1 0 1 S 0 0 0 0 0 1 1 1 The values under the S column are obtained from interpreting the description of when we want the siren to turn on. When M = 0, we don’t want the siren to come on, regardless of what the values for D and V are.
Since S = 1 if x = 1 and S = 0 if x = 0, we can write S=x This logic expression describes the output S in terms of the input variable x. 4. 4 Connection of two binary switches: (a) in series; (b) in parallel. If two switches are connected in series as in (a), then both switches have to be on in order for the output F to be a 1. In other words, F = 1 if x = 1 AND y = 1. If either x or y is off, or both are off, then F = 0. Translating this into a logic expression, we get F = x AND y Hence, two switches connected in series give rise to the logical AND operator.